Links to a number of organisations which offer help to children in deprived areas.
Victim Support
www.victimsupport.org
Victim Support is the national charity which helps people affected by crime. They provide free and confidential support to help you deal with your experience, whether or not you report the crime. Their support line is 0845 3030900
Support After Murder and Manslaughter
www.samm.org.uk
SAMM offers emotional support to those bereaved through murder and manslaughter. Their helpline is 0207 7353838

Community Links
www.community-links.org
Community Links is an innovative inner city charity running community-based projects in east London. Founded in 1977, they help over 50,000 vulnerable children, young people and adults every year, with most of their work based in Newham, one of the poorest boroughs in Europe.
